Output 0761010b443056f203acecee5ec36f67be8e52bcba5cf25264a2e53b13175d7a:2

value
126976
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ca07561b7b047e5f5bf6e158f5262032a434009 OP_EQUALVERIFY OP_CHECKSIG
address
17zAaS6amxHestbWSfX97xYb4NCK4FpPd6
transaction
0761010b443056f203acecee5ec36f67be8e52bcba5cf25264a2e53b13175d7a
confirmations
139821
spent
true